Ruby Rare

In addition to being a “queer, non-monogamous jelly enthusiast”, Ruby Rare is a phenomenal sex educator. Since starting her career at Brook, the UK’s leading sexual health charity for young people, she’s become one of Instagram’s leading sex-positive creatives and co-founder of the awesome Body Love Sketch Club. Committed to challenging preconceived notions about what sex “should” look like, Ruby is a pink-haired fountain of wisdom.
